Ball Mills an overview ScienceDirect Topics
With dry grinding, these mills often work in a closed cycle. A scheme of the conical ball mill supplied with an air separator is shown in Fig. 2.13. Air is fed to the mill by means of a fan. Carried off by air currents, the product arrives at the air separator, from which the coarse particles are returned by gravity via a tube into the mill.

Patterson Industries Continuous-Type Ball & Pebble Mills
In the closed circuit system, fine particles are removed from the finished product and oversized particles are returned to the mill. Grinding Density Fineness of Grind Continuous Mills may be used to grind products with a fineness of 1/4" (6.5 mm) to 10 microns, (.01 mm).

Raw Material Drying-Grinding Cement Plant Optimization
Closed circuit ball mill with two compartments for coarse and fine grinding and a drying compartment with lifters are generally found in cement plants for raw material grinding. Compartments (filled with grinding media) are divided by a double diaphragm with flow control to utilize maximum mill
